If you currently work for Brown-Forman, please apply by clicking the Careers icon on the Workday portal. For best results, use Google Chrome to view this page. Meaningful Work From Day One Support the Woodford Reserve 2nd Shift Processing operations ( Monday- Friday 3:00 PM
- 11:30 PM) including barrel handling, liquid processing, inventory management, and personal selection activities.
- Monitor available bottling tanks and partner with the Operations Manager and Lead Processing/Regauge Operator to coordinate liquid transfers.
- Load and unload tankers to support bottling operations and off-site bottling schedules.
- Perform batching, analytical, and proofing tests on finished whiskey and processing tanks, ensuring quality standards are met and results are accurately documented.
- Collaborate with Operations leadership to determine barrel dump quantities and timing to support formulation requirements, bulk tanks, processing tanks, and tanker operations.
- Support barrel handling activities, including warehouse movements, truck unloading, stacking barrels, and dumping operations.
- Collect and document liquid and barrel samples as required by process standards.
- Maintain accurate records of liquid movements, quality testing, and inventory transactions through Regauge Sheets, Salesforce, and other designated systems.
- Accurately record downtime events in TrackSYS.
- Provide processing support across both T1 and T2 operations as needed.
